Dude. Watching you work is like watching a monkey hump a football. That should of been done with four pieces, lot less work, less welding, less grinding, way easier to blend. Your leak test, is bad idea. Got water in the tank. Now going to rust out the weld areas. Smart way is to add max 1 lbs of air and spray outside with soap and water. Btw, pressure testing with air is highly dangerous. A small weak spot even in the untouched steel can blow out.
